Tabla de contenido:
- Suministros
- Paso 1: Paso 1: Conexión de la pantalla LCD
- Paso 2: Paso 2: Potenciómetro
- Paso 3: Paso 3: Receptor de infrarrojos
- Paso 4: Paso 4: Configuración del motor paso a paso
- Paso 5: Paso 5: el código
- Paso 6: Paso 6: Código final
Video: Sistema de bloqueo del hogar con pantalla LCD: 6 pasos
2024 Autor: John Day | [email protected]. Última modificación: 2024-01-30 08:40
Este proyecto actuará como una cerradura de la casa, y la única forma de entrar a la casa es presionando el código correcto de 3 dígitos. La pantalla LCD actuará como un dispositivo de comunicación para informar al individuo si ha ingresado el código correcto o no. El receptor de infrarrojos actuará como dispositivo para recibir información del usuario y, finalmente, el motor paso a paso se desbloqueará y "abrirá" la puerta de la casa si se ha introducido el código correcto.
Suministros
- Pantalla LCD 16 * 2
- receptor IR
- Motor paso a paso
- Placa de controlador ULN2003
- Cables de puente
- Potenciómetro
- Tablero de circuitos
- Resistencia de 10 K
Paso 1: Paso 1: Conexión de la pantalla LCD
El primer paso que desea completar antes de ensamblar su LCD es conectar la placa de pruebas a 5V y GND.
- Conecte el primer pin a GND
- Conecte el segundo pin a la alimentación
- Conecte el tercer pin al pin central del potenciómetro
- Conecte el cuarto pin al pin 2 en el Arduino
- Conecte el quinto pin a GND
- Conecte el sexto pin a A4
- Conecte el pin 11 a A3
- Conecte el pin 12 a A2
- Conecte el pin 13 a A1
- Conecte el pin 14 a A0
- Conecte el pin 15 a una resistencia de 10 K ohmios que se conecta a la alimentación
- Conecte el pin 16 a GND
Paso 2: Paso 2: Potenciómetro
- Conecte el pin del extremo derecho a Power
- Conecte el pin del extremo izquierdo a GND
- Conecte el pin medio al pin 3 en la pantalla LCD
Paso 3: Paso 3: Receptor de infrarrojos
Hay 3 patas en el receptor de infrarrojos. La pierna en el extremo derecho es VCC (potencia), la pierna en el extremo izquierdo si está FUERA (se conecta a un pin) y la pierna del medio es para GND.
- Conecte el VCC al riel de alimentación en la placa de pruebas
- Conecte el pin de SALIDA a A2 en el Arduino
- Conecte el pin GND al riel de tierra en la placa de pruebas
Paso 4: Paso 4: Configuración del motor paso a paso
Siga el circuito de arriba. Asegúrese de conectar las clavijas blancas en el módulo de la unidad y luego comience a conectar las clavijas del módulo de la unidad en la parte superior de las clavijas de Arduino.
Paso 5: Paso 5: el código
Antes de comenzar con el código, asegúrese de obtener un control remoto de TV y decodificar los códigos HEX para su control remoto. Debería decodificar 3 números para este proyecto (para la contraseña de su 'casa'). No olvide descargar la biblioteca de control remoto por infrarrojos.
Para hacer esto use este código:
#incluir
configuración vacía () {
Serial.begin (9600);
irReceiver.enableIRIn (); }
bucle vacío () {
if (irReceiver.decode (& result)) {
irReceiver.resume ();
Serial.println (valor.resultado, HEX); }}
Paso 6: Paso 6: Código final
Aquí está el código final para este sistema de desbloqueo doméstico. Asegúrese de cambiar los códigos hexadecimales superiores a los códigos hexadecimales que ha recibido a través de su control remoto de TV. Si tiene alguna pregunta, no dude en preguntarme en los comentarios a continuación.
Recomendado:
Pantalla LCD I2C / IIC - Use una pantalla LCD SPI para la pantalla LCD I2C usando el módulo SPI a IIC con Arduino: 5 pasos
Pantalla LCD I2C / IIC | Use una pantalla LCD SPI para la pantalla LCD I2C usando el módulo SPI a IIC con Arduino: Hola a todos, ya que una pantalla LCD SPI 1602 normal tiene demasiados cables para conectar, por lo que es muy difícil conectarlo con arduino, pero hay un módulo disponible en el mercado que puede Convierta la pantalla SPI en la pantalla IIC, por lo que solo necesita conectar 4 cables
Pantalla LCD I2C / IIC - Convierta una pantalla LCD SPI en una pantalla LCD I2C: 5 pasos
Pantalla LCD I2C / IIC | Convierta una pantalla LCD SPI en la pantalla LCD I2C: el uso de la pantalla lcd spi necesita demasiadas conexiones, lo cual es realmente difícil de hacer, así que encontré un módulo que puede convertir la pantalla lcd i2c en la pantalla lcd spi, así que comencemos
Manera rápida y fácil de cambiar la pantalla de bloqueo en 6 sencillos pasos (Windows 8-10): 7 pasos
Manera rápida y fácil de cambiar la pantalla de bloqueo en 6 sencillos pasos (Windows 8-10): ¿Desea cambiar las cosas en su computadora portátil o PC? ¿Quieres un cambio en tu atmósfera? Siga estos pasos rápidos y sencillos para personalizar con éxito la pantalla de bloqueo de su computadora
Automatización del hogar: suena una alarma y se muestra en la pantalla LCD cuando la temperatura está por encima del valor umbral: 5 pasos
Automatización del hogar: haga sonar una alarma y se mostrará en la pantalla LCD cuando la temperatura esté por encima del valor umbral: este blog demostrará cómo hacer un sistema de automatización del hogar que comenzará a hacer sonar una alarma cuando la temperatura alcance más del valor umbral programado. Seguirá mostrando la temperatura actual de la habitación en la pantalla LCD y se necesita acción
Panel de control del hogar y sincronización familiar montado en la pared con pantalla táctil: 7 pasos (con imágenes)
Sincronización familiar montada en la pared con pantalla táctil y panel de control del hogar: Tenemos un calendario que se actualiza mensualmente con eventos, pero se hace manualmente. También tendemos a olvidar cosas de las que nos hemos quedado sin otras tareas menores. En esta época, pensé que era mucho más fácil tener un calendario sincronizado y un sistema de tipos de bloc de notas que c